If #PFCC eligibility were expanded to 150% FPL in Ohio...
- About 16,900 additional infants & toddlers could receive access to #childcare in an average month
- Nearly 3,900 additional mothers would be able to join the workforce

ODH Director Dr. Amy Acton says the young adult from Stark County recently traveled to a state with confirmed cases. This is the first confirmed measles case in Ohio since 2017. 28 states already have measles cases, several having confirmed outbreaks.
